I can reproduce this with the 4.2.0 and later appimages up to the Sep30 4.4.1-alpha (git 30803ef) appimage.
I attach an example file, RedAndBlueAnim.kra for convenience of testing.
ST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Open the attached example file and select the group layer and frame-0.
2. Select the Transform tool and click on the canvas and perform a transform action.
[NOTE: The transform bounding box shows the frame contents inside it. The transform action works.]
3. Select frame-2 or frame-4 of the group layer and perform a transform on it.
[NOTE: The transform bounding box contents are not visible. If a transform action is performed and then completed, the correctly transformed contents become visible.
OBSERVED RESULT
See Steps To Reproduce.
Transforming a held frame of frame-0 does show the contents.
Transforming a held frame of frame-2 or frame-4 does not show the contents.
(A transform of a held frame results in a new keyframe of the transformed contents.)
EXPECTED RESULT
The content of the grouped frames should be visible in the transform bounding box.
